在当今快速发展的软件开发和测试领域,选择一个适合的小型化测试开发平台至关重要。以下是一些推荐的小型化测试开发平台,以及它们各自的特点和优势:
推荐的小型化测试开发平台
- autotestplat:一款开源的一站式自动化测试平台,支持API、APP UI、Web UI性能等自动化测试,具备测试用例管理、产品管理、任务计划、测试报告等功能模块。其轻量化的设计使得不会代码的手工业务测试人员也能参与自动化测试工作。
- RunnerGo:基于Go语言研发,支持接口管理、场景管理、性能测试、自动化测试等功能。它的设计理念是“为研发赋能,让测试更简单”,具有开源、轻量级、全栈式等优点,非常适合希望简化测试流程的团队。
- data4test:专为复杂业务系统的测试工作设计,支持功能、并发、异常、模糊、场景、长时间、国际化、大数据、性能等方面的测试。它的使用友好,编写友好,扩展灵活,运维友好,文档友好,跨平台友好,非常适合需要全面测试覆盖的开发团队。
各个平台的优势
- autotestplat:优势在于其轻量级和易用性,能够快速搭建,适合资源有限的环境。
- RunnerGo:优势在于其基于Go语言,运行速度快,资源消耗低,且功能全面,适合需要高性能测试的平台。
- data4test:优势在于其专为复杂业务系统设计,支持多种测试类型,适合需要深度测试覆盖的场景。
选择适合的测试开发平台考虑因素
在选择小型化测试开发平台时,考虑以下因素至关重要:
- 功能需求:平台是否支持所需的测试类型,如接口测试、UI测试、性能测试等。
- 易用性:平台是否易于上手,配置和维护。
- 资源消耗:平台对系统资源的需求,特别是在资源有限的环境中。
- 社区和支持:平台是否有活跃的社区和良好的文档支持,以便在遇到问题时能够快速获得帮助。
在选择小型化测试开发平台时,建议考虑平台的功能需求、易用性、资源消耗以及社区和支持等因素。根据具体的项目需求和个人偏好,选择一个最适合的工具,可以大大提高测试效率,降低测试成本。